General description

GranuCult® prime VRB (Violet Red Bile Lactose) agar is used for the detection and colony counting of coliform bacteria. Crystal violet and bile salts inhibit the growth of the Gram-positive accompanying bacterial flora. Degradation of lactose to acid is indicated by the pH indicator neutral red, which changes its color to red, and by precipitation of bile acids. The enzymatic digest of animal tissue provides carbon and nitrogen sources for bacterial growth. Yeast extract primarily supplies the B-complex vitamins, while agar is the solidifying agent.

Application

GranuCult® prime Violet Red Bile Lactose (VBRL) agar is suitable for the detection and colony counting of coliform bacteria from food and animal feed, water, and other materials.

Analysis Note

Appearance (clearness): clear
Appearance (colour): red
pH-value (25 °C): 7.2 - 7.6
Solidification behaviour (2 hrs., 45 °C): liquid
Growth promotion test in accordance with the current version of DIN EN ISO 11133.
Inoculum on reference medium (Escherichia coli ATCC 8739 (WDCM 00012)):
Colony count (Escherichia coli ATCC 8739 (WDCM 00012)):
Recovery on test medium (Escherichia coli ATCC 8739 (WDCM 00012)): ≥ 50 %
Colony colour (Escherichia coli ATCC 8739 (WDCM 00012)): purplish-red colonies with or without precipitate halo
Inoculum on reference medium (Escherichia coli ATCC 25922 (WDCM 00013)):
Colony count (Escherichia coli ATCC 25922 (WDCM 00013)):
Recovery on test medium (Escherichia coli ATCC 25922 (WDCM 00013)): ≥ 50 %
Colony colour (Escherichia coli ATCC 25922 (WDCM 00013)): purplish-red colonies with or without precipitate halo
Inoculum on reference medium (Enterobacter cloacae ATCC 13047 (WDCM 00083)):
Colony count (Enterobacter cloacae ATCC 13047 (WDCM 00083)):
Recovery on test medium (Enterobacter cloacae ATCC 13047 (WDCM 00083)): ≥ 50 %
Colony colour (Enterobacter cloacae ATCC 13047 (WDCM 00083)): purplish-red colonies with or without precipitate halo
Growth (Pseudomonas aeruginosa ATCC 27853 (WDCM 00025)): no limit
Colony colour (Pseudomonas aeruginosa ATCC 27853 (WDCM 00025)): colourless to beige colonies
Growth (Enterococcus faecalis ATCC 19433 (WDCM 00009)): total inhibition
Growth (Enterococcus faecalis ATCC 29212 (WDCM 00087)): total inhibition
Incubation: 24 ± 2 hours at 30 ± 1 °C
Reference media: Tryptic Soy Agar
A recovery rate of 50 % is equivalent to a productivity value of 0.5.
The indicated colony counts result from the sum of a triple determination.

Other Notes

  • The prepared medium is clear and red
  • If the medium is to be used immediately for the poured plate technique, cool it to 44-47 °C in a water bath before use
  • If the medium is used for the surface plating technique, there should be no visible moisture on the plates before use
  • The prepared plates can be stored at 2 °C to 8 °C in the dark and protected against evaporation for up to 5 days
